The Chemistry Annex 7B is shown here as Herrick Archives number H 418. It was located on West Nineteenth Avenue near College Road on the Ohio State University campus. This building was made up of twelve war surplus buildings brought to the site and reassembled. This diagram denotes the following: southwest wings demolished in 1957 (dotted portion), area caught on fire in 1957 (cross-hatching), remainder demolished in 1962 (white space).
